ABSTRACT

The idea of optical interconnect is to optical technology to transmit or connect devices, components, and subsystems instead of metal wiring. The advantage of optical interconnect includes its high speed capability basically with no limit, light weight, and low power consumption. Another important issue is parallel lightwave systems including numerous optical fibers. By taking this advantage, the optical interconnect is considered to be inevitable also in the computer technology. Some parallel interconnect schemes and new concepts are being researched. Vertical optical interconnect of Large Scale Integration chips and circuit boards may be another interesting issue. The two-dimensional arrayed configuration of surface emitting lasers and planar optics will give way to a new era of opto-electronics. Massively integrated parallel optical devices are becoming important for use in future parallel electronics such as optical routing systems, optical data transfer, optical image processing, parallel optical recording.
